Pros of Tamko Composite Decking

Durability and Maintenance

Tamko composite decking is known for its high durability, which translates into fewer maintenance requirements compared to traditional wooden decks. Users report that this product resists scratches, stains, and fading, making it an excellent long-term investment. Additionally, the material does not rot or warp, even under extreme weather conditions (Tamko Products).

Environmental Benefits

One of the key advantages of Tamko composite decking is its environmental impact. The materials used are often recycled from plastic and wood waste, reducing landfill space and conserving natural resources. Furthermore, the production process emits fewer greenhouse gases than the extraction and processing of raw timber (Green Building Elements).

Aesthetic Appeal

Tamko composite decking offers a wide range of colors and textures, allowing homeowners to customize their outdoor spaces according to personal preferences. The realistic wood grain finish gives it a natural look that complements any landscape design (The Home Depot).

Cons of Tamko Composite Decking

Cost Considerations

While Tamko composite decking offers numerous benefits, it comes at a higher initial cost compared to traditional wood options. However, the longevity and low-maintenance nature of the product can offset these costs over time. Some users have reported that while the upfront investment is significant, the long-term savings on maintenance make it a worthwhile choice (Family Handyman).

Installation Challenges

Installing Tamko composite decking can be more challenging than working with traditional wood. The materials require specific tools and techniques, which may necessitate hiring professional installers. While this adds to the overall cost, the end result is a deck that is both functional and aesthetically pleasing (This Old House).
